      • Physical activity is movement that is carried out by the skeletal muscles that requires energy. In other words, any movement one does is actually physical activity. Exercise, however, is planned, structured, repetitive and intentional movement intended to improve or maintain physical fitness. Exercise is a subcategory of physical activity.

    Adults should get at least 150 minutes of moderate intensity or 75 minutes of vigorous intensity aerobic exercise per week.
    The time can be broken down into smaller portions, such as walking 30 minutes a day for five days a week.
    Adults should resistance train each major muscle group on at least two non-consecutive days per week.

    During cancer treatment, a reduced amount of exercise can still be helpful in improving common symptoms. Try 30 minutes of aerobic exercise three times a week, plus twice-weekly strength training, to improve fatigue, quality of life, physical function, sleep and bone health and reduce anxiety and depression.

  5. Oct 5, 2022 · WHO defines physical activity as any bodily movement produced by skeletal muscles that requires energy expenditure. Physical activity refers to all movement including during leisure time, for transport to get to and from places, or as part of a person’s work. Both moderate- and vigorous-intensity physical activity improve health.
